08:27Out of all the surprises Season 2 threw our way,
08:30none matched the introduction of Kahori.
08:33Who is Kahori, you may ask?
08:35She's an original character, purposely created for What If.
08:39As a young Mohawk woman who came into contact with the Tesseract,
08:42Kahori soon developed powers matching that of the Space Stone,
08:45like super speed, strength, and cosmic energy manipulation.
08:48She and her people were able to defeat the invading Conquistadors and essentially rewrite history,
09:03all before being recruited by Strange Supreme.
09:11While it seems like such an out-of-left-field move,
09:14Kahori's story and unique background were so captivating
09:17that she's become an MCU icon in her own right,
09:20practically a deuteragonist.

09:41Number 1.
09:42The Death of Strange Supreme
09:44What If's high point remains the downfall of this alternative version of Dr. Strange,
09:49whose desire to save his beloved Christine from an apparently inescapable death
09:53led him to tear his universe asunder.
